Millwall boss Neil Harris hails 'electric' fans for Leicester shock

Millwall boss Neil Harris hailed the home fans after their FA Cup defeat of Leicester City.

Millwall progressed to the sixth round of the Emirates FA Cup at Leicester's expense after Shaun Cummings scored in the 90th minute at the Den.

"Going down to 10 men just after half time is tough," Millwall manager Harris said. "It put the pressure and expectation on to Leicester's shoulders and my players did not freeze. It galvanised the stadium.

"The atmosphere in the stadium was electric. It carried the players and my players carried the stadium because of the pressing with 10 men, the closing down and the chances we created. It was everything you would want from a Millwall team."
